The usual form of this sandhi in modern Sanskrit is described as the a- dropping and being replaced by avagraha. If word boundaries are represented by SPACE, am I correct in believing that the change in codepoints is:
<U+0020 SPACE, U+0905 LETTER A> becomes <U+200B ZERO WIDTH SPACE, U+093D DEVANAGARI SIGN AVAGRAHA> I ask because I have seen lines starting with avagraha, though within a line there seems not to be a space before avagraha.
